When creating a cause-and-effect diagram, the following steps are taken: (1) Determine the issue (characteristic) and create the backbone. (In production technology, identify the details of defects, etc.) (2) Create the major bones. (It is easier to understand if you categorize the major bones according to the 5M1E.) (3) Create the middle bones (list the contents that could be factors of the major bones). (4) Create the minor bones (list the contents that could be factors of the middle bones). The characteristic of the cause-and-effect diagram is to organize the factors into major bones, middle bones, and minor bones, and visualize them to make it easier to grasp the overall picture. The cause-and-effect diagram is used for cause investigation, issue organization, information sharing, and more. The 5M1E of the major bone section refers to: 1. Machine (Technology) 2. Method (Process) 3. Material (Includes information on raw materials and consumables.) 4. Manpower (Physical labor) / Mind power (Brain function) 5. Measurement (Inspection) 6. Environment If this cause-and-effect diagram can be applied to various issues in production technology operations, it will contribute to improving operational efficiency.
